DRAMA

Harvest Home (World Citizen)  - Sat  28 Jan

All Saints Sea Scouts

ADMISSION £2

2pm.

All Saints Sea Scouts and Guides will travel from their home territory in Four Oaks, Sutton Coldfield to Bloxwich to perform a play based on global climate change, poverty, pollution and endangered species.

The story is told through drama, music, dance, poetry and singing and was written by Walsall’s temporary Poet Laureate,  assistant scout leader Ian Henery.  All proceeds will go to a charity called Forever Angels (set up by a former All Saints Sea Scout), which is an orphanage in Tanzani, Africa catering for orphans, abandoned children and children who are HIV positive.

Bloxwich Film Society – Saturday 11 February

Film Society

Bloxwich Film Society, first formed in 1964, is being relaunched at Bookmark Theatre on the evening of Saturday 11 February 2012 at 7.30pm for 8pm – and you are invited!

The original Bloxwich Film Society was launched in 1964, using 16mm film projection from the dedicated projection box in Bloxwich Library Theatre.  The revived society will use the theatre’s High Definition large-screen video projection facilities from Blu-Ray and DVD.

The first film, to be shown on the relaunch night, is the 40th anniversary restored version of ‘The Italian Job’, starring Michael Caine.

NO TICKET REQUIRED - Admission to this launch event is FREE subject to availability of seats!

Membership of Bloxwich Film Society will cost £10 in 2012, and you can sign up on the relaunch night or at the next film performance.

Future performances, which will be every other month, will be for MEMBERS ONLY and will be free of charge to members.

In 2012 films showing will be great classics of the 1960s and 1970s, in celebration of the original society and the theatre.
